Output 65b8849be95b129f83e6190ae3981fbb449c29863d63b5bc3cb1e4421ac5f0ff:3144

value
577996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f77fcf02d3c17102c77e6d463caece15aaf8063 OP_EQUAL
address
3K9Qj6fhBZPig4U9wPsVWQscz8FrCfnEpb
transaction
65b8849be95b129f83e6190ae3981fbb449c29863d63b5bc3cb1e4421ac5f0ff
confirmations
346071
spent
true